作者 主題: C#用datagridview連接ORACLE特殊字顯示不出來  (閱讀 5574 次)

0 會員 與 1 訪客 正在閱讀本文。

brent77622

  • 可愛的小學生
  • *
  • 文章數: 6
    • 檢視個人資料
我的環境是:VC2010,C#,framework 4.0用 ADO.NET連線
請問各位大大有沒有碰到這樣的問題
                          例如:
                                     姓名
                                    "張玲玉"
                              在datagridview 上面卻顯示  "張口玉"  之後不管複製到哪都會變成"張?玉" 但是我用PLSQL下同樣的指令去看是正常的!!!
                              我原本想說是編碼的問題並且安裝unicodeaton_250(日語補完計畫)
                              可惜還是一樣會變成   "張口玉"     :'( :'(

大部分的中文字顯示都很正常,只有少部分這樣
請問有沒有辦法解決這樣的問題呢??     


-----------------------------------------------------------------------------------------------------------------------------------------------------------------------
因為某些原因 無法使用ODBC32做連線
但是我用delphi 跟 power builder 都沒有這樣的問題
似乎只有.NET會這樣
感謝各位
« 上次編輯: 2012-03-19 19:16 由 brent77622 »

brent77622

  • 可愛的小學生
  • *
  • 文章數: 6
    • 檢視個人資料
Re: C#用datagridview連接ORACLE特殊字顯示不出來
« 回覆 #1 於: 2012-05-02 16:28 »
之後用OLEDB連線就可以解決了 :)